Gorgeous landscape lighting for your home will not only enhance the beauty of your property but also provide safety and security.  And with the right combination of ambient and task lighting, creating a yard that is as beautiful at night as during the day can easily be accomplished.  When deciding where to place landscape lights it is important to keep in mind your views from indoors, the focal points in the yard you want to highlight, safety and security.  Also, creating a sense of depth throughout the landscape will add ambiance and personality to your yard. Building a new house gives homeowners a chance to create a home that reflects their unique style, specific needs, and true personality.  But, owners must be careful that the choices they make will pay on the resale, when the time comes to sell.  When choosing options for a new home, stay neutral, particularly when it comes to the higher end items such as countertops, cabinetry, and flooring. Personalize easily modified things like wall paint colors and cabinet hardware. Several upgrades for a new home that consistently pay on resale include the kitchen area, high-end flooring, lots of closet and storage space, quality windows and manufactured stone veneer or brick for the exterior.
